Giving your bathroom a fresh look with a standup shower can completely transform the vibe of your personal space. It doesn’t matter if your bathroom is large or cozy; there’s a shower design that will perfectly suit your style and cater to your needs.
1. Use Cool Room Shapes
Use the cool shapes in your house to make a special spot for your shower. These smart ideas make the most of the space and add something interesting.
2. Get Smart with Storage
Put in shelves or little alcoves in your shower to keep it neat. Smart storage is a big help, keeping all your stuff in order and easy to grab.
3. Get Creative with Tile
Playing around with different tile patterns can really inject some personality into your shower area. I’ve learned that whether it’s lively mosaics or calm marbles, picking the right pattern can reinvent your whole bathroom’s feel.
4. Wow Them with Strong Colors
Don’t be scared to use strong colors in your shower. A brave color can make your shower a cool thing to see and make the whole bathroom better.
5. Add Relaxation with Seating
Think about adding a seat or stool in your shower to make it more comfy. It might seem small, but it’s a big deal, especially when you want long, soothing showers.
6. Think About Tiles from Floor to Top
Use tiles that go from the floor to the top to get a look that fits together and feels fancy. This choice makes the room look classy and also makes it feel taller and bigger.
7. Make a Spa Feel with Tubs that Stand Alone
If you have enough room, add a tub that stands alone to your shower for the most luxurious experience. This mix turns your bathroom into a personal spa.
8. Include Modern Hardware
Upgrade your shower using modern showerheads and faucets. These sleek, simple designs look amazing and bring a bit of luxury to your everyday life.
9. Go for See-Through Glass Surrounds
Showers with frameless glass give off a super stylish vibe and help your bathroom feel more open. I’ve noticed that these elegant designs can make even the tiniest bathrooms seem bigger.
10. Use Pretty Details
Make your shower lively and welcoming using decorative touches such as plants or artwork. A plant or a cool piece of art can really turn your shower into a peaceful hideaway.
11. Make the Most of Space with Corner Showers
Corner showers are a great solution for smaller bathrooms, making use of spots we usually overlook. I’ve added these to numerous designs and they always wow me with their practicality and style.
12. Try Shower Screens That Are Tinted
A shower screen that has a tint adds something special to your bathroom. This little thing can turn your shower into a cool thing to look at.
13. Make Edges with How Things Feel
Using different feels in your shower can show where spaces are and make it more interesting. I’ve learned that how things feel can make the room seem bigger.
14. Add a Sauna Time
Add a sauna to your shower for a real spa experience at home. This great set-up lets you relax and feel new whenever you want.
15. Find the Beauty in Showers That Are Open
A shower that is open can mix in with the rest of your bathroom, making the room feel bigger. I like how this makes everything flow together.
16. Make Space Feel Bigger with Big Tiles
Big tiles can make a small shower feel big by having fewer lines between them. This makes the room look smooth and big, which is modern.
17. Let Sunshine Flood In
Put your shower near a window or under a skylight to drench the area in natural light. This brightens up your bathroom and boosts the general mood.
18. Choose Tiles That Go Up and Down
Tiles that go up and down make your eyes look up, making the room seem taller. This trick is great for small showers to make them feel bigger.
